Lanchester, Consett and Stanley Petty Sessional Division
Reference: PS/La Catalogue Title: Lanchester, Consett and Stanley Petty Sessional Division Area: Catalogue Category: Public Records Description: Licensing
Covering Dates: 1897-1977
Access: Please note that some court records are subject to 100 year closure under Data Protection legislation. Apply to County Archivist for access.

Removal of licences to new premises (Ref: PS/La )Ref: PS/La 86Application for the removal of the licence of the Royal Hotel, Blackhill to premises at Stanefordham, Consett at the Brewster Sessions for the Petty Sessional Division of Lanchester, Consett and Stanley, 8 February 1954
[Includes plans and photographs of interior and exterior of existing and proposed premises]
(1 volume, cloth bound)
Ref: PS/La 87Application for the removal of the licence of the Masons Arms, Iveston to a site at the junction of Severn Crescent and Orwell Gardens, South Stanley at the adjourned Brewster Sessions for the Petty Sessional Division of Lanchester, Consett and Stanley, 8 March 1954. [Includes plans and photographs of interior and exterior of existing and proposed premises]
Attached: Plan showing location of proposed new hotel, 1954
Scale: 25" to 1 mile [1:2500]
(1 volume, cloth bound, 1 plan)
Ref: PS/La 88Application for the removal of the licence of the Smelter's Arms, Castleside to Castleside House, Castleside, at the adjourned Brewster Sessions for the Petty Sessional Division of Lanchester, Consett and Stanley, 8 March 1954
[Includes plans and photographs of interior and exterior of existing and proposed premises]
Attached: Plan showing location of proposed new premises, 1954
Scale: 25" to 1 mile [1:2500]
(1 volume, cloth bound, 1 plan)
